Although some things can stain or discolor teeth, the most common reasons are the following:
* drinking coffee, tea, colas and also other liquids that will stain the teeth
* heredity
* tetracycline (an antibiotic) use
* aging
* excessive usage of abrasives, which often can expose the teeths’ dentin and cause severe discoloration
* excessive fluoride
* old fillings
Toothpastes including whitening agents among their ingredients can minimize surface staining, also is known as by dental professionals as extrinsic staining. However, whitening toothpastes and professional teeth cleanings will not likely alter intrinsic staining in the teeth. Teeth whiteners are generally categorized into two groups, namely, professional whitening procedures and home-based teeth whiteners.
Professional whitening procedures tend to be performed in a dentists’ office and involve the use of whitening gels which might be activated by light from the laser.
Home-based teeth whiteners, in contrast, can be carried out by anyone, in a choice of between professional treatments or without the other whitening procedures. Home-based whiteners can contain whitening kits and tray-based whitening systems, or they could be homemade treatments using culinary and medicinal ingredients.
As being the name implies, home-based whitening is frequently performed in the home, as per a schedule suggested by dentists and/or your products instructions.
Tray-based whitening is often a four-step process, as set forth below.
1. The kit will include a tray that is certainly to get customized from the persons dentist to suit snugly on the persons teeth. A definative fit is crucial.
2. The whitening gel as part of the kit flows over the tray.
3. The gels ingredient, carbamide peroxide, reduces to allow for oxygen to enter the teeths enamel and bleach the discolored areas.
4. The structure of the teeth is not altered in any respect from this procedure. Bonding, fillings and crowns will not lighten but discolored areas about the teeth themselves will.

How does tray whitening differ from other professional teeth whitening procedures?
Listed here are a lot of the professional whitening products dentists consider for usage within their professional whitening services. The bleaching laser or light each product uses follows in parentheses.
* LaserSmile (Biolase laser)
* Rembrandt Sapphire (plasma arc light)
* LumaArch (halogen light)
* BriteSmile (gas plasma light/light emitting diode)
* Zoom! (metal halide light)
Laser whitening typically necessitates the putting on a 35% hydrogen peroxide gel-based solution at first glance on the persons teeth. The laser or other light is then held at the person’s mouth and it is light activates the peroxide. Some dentists and manufacturers claim this technique works more effectively than tray whitening, but no actual data supports those claims.
